Today in England all roads lead to Wembley, where one of the greatest sporting events of the year is taking place-the Football Association Cup Final match between Manchester United and Aston Villa.

On Sunday morning, at 12.15, Radio Hongkong is broadcasting the first of two talks called "Mozart in his Lettera". The first talk is entitled "Youth", and contains the letters writien by Mozart to his family during hir visits to Italy. and inter when he was in Paris "secking his fortune", and it is possible to form some

idea of Mozart's

life and character from his cor- respondence.

Wednesday Theatre this week at 8,45 p.m. presents "The Bir- mingham Jewel Robbery," A thriller for broadcasting by Ed ward J. Mason, who wrote and introduced the short crime episodes in the series "Guilty Party" which was broadcast on Radio Hongkong last year..

This ploy Is primarily with the repercussions of the crime and not with the robbery-itself, which is an event of the past. Henry Gordon, who went to prison for the robbery, to about to be released after having served his sentence. His actions lead to a and

rated chain of bluff counter-bluff, with a good deal of double-crossing and a Mir- prise finish.

The Recital on Monday night at 9.30 will be given by Joan Hadland (soprano), who has become well-known to music lovers in Hongkong during her comparatively short residence

through her appearances at local concerts. She will be ac companied by Moya Rea on the ptano, und die programme "in◄ cludes'. gong by the English composern, Peter Warlock and Arnold Bax.
